Sommario/riassunto: | Now in its second completely revised and expanded edition. Written by the renowned editors B. Cornils and W. A. Herrmann, this book presents every important aspect of aqueous-phase organometallic catalysis, a method which saves time, waste and money. The large-scale application of this ""green"" technology in chemical industry clearly underlines its practical use outside of academia.New chapters (for example ""Organic Chemistry in Water""), 20% more content and fully updated contributions from by a plethora of international authors make this book a ""must-have"" for everyone working in thi |
